Find the volume of a pyramid with a square base, where the side length of the base is

18.5 in and the height of the pyramid is 10.9 in. Round your answer to the nearest
tenth of a cubic inch.​

Answer:

V = 1243.5 in³

Explanation:

The volume of a square pyramid is given as

V = (1/3) b²h,

where,

V = volume of square pyramid (we are asked to find this)

b = base length (given as 18.5 in)

h = height (given as 10.9 in)

Substituting the given values above into the equation:

V = (1/3) b²h

V = (1/3) (18.5)²(10.9)

V = 1243.5083

V = 1243.5 in³ (rounded to nearest tenth)
